Understanding the Basics: What is a VIN?
Every vehicle built after 1981 is assigned a unique 17-digit identifier known as a Vehicle Identification Number (VIN). The system is standardized by the International Organization for Standardization (ISO), ensuring that each VIN is globally unique and can be deciphered regardless of language, location, or manufacturer. A Toyota VIN allows you to get details like country of origin, manufacturer, vehicle type, trim, and even production sequence.
Key facts about VINs:
- 17 characters long, made up of numbers (0–9) and letters (A–Z), excluding I, O, and Q to prevent confusion with digits 1 and 0
- Must be visible on the dashboard on the driver’s side and on a sticker located in the driver-side door jamb
- Plays a crucial role in recalls, registration, insurance coverage, and vehicle history reports
Breaking Down a Toyota VIN: 17 Characters, 17 Clues
Let’s go step-by-step through the structure of a Toyota VIN. Each character tells a unique detail of the vehicle, and understanding them all together can give you a detailed profile of that specific model. Toyota VINs follow the standard North American format, broken into three key sections:
- World Manufacturer Identifier (WMI) — characters 1 to 3
- Vehicle Descriptor Section (VDS) — characters 4 to 9
- Vehicle Identifier Section (VIS) — characters 10 to 17
We’ll explore these sections in detail.
Section 1: World Manufacturer Identifier (WMI)
The first three characters are the World Manufacturer Identifier, which tells you where and by whom the vehicle was made.
Character 1: Country of Origin
Character 1 identifies the country where the vehicle was manufactured. Here are the primary allocations for vehicles destined for the North American market:

Character 9: Check Digit
The ninth character is a check digit used to validate the VIN. This digit is calculated mathematically using a formula involving the other 16 characters, and helps detect invalid or altered VINs.
If you’re entering a VIN for a title transfer, registration, or vehicle history report, the system cross-checks this digit to ensure the input is correct. A mismatched check digit can indicate a tampered or falsified VIN.

Characters 12–17: Production Sequence
The final six digits serve as the vehicle’s production serial number. This sequence ensures no two vehicles have the same VIN. It’s also used by Toyota dealers and service centers to track specific parts and repair records.

Why Decoding a Toyota VIN Matters
A VIN is more than a sequence of letters and numbers—it is a vehicle’s unique fingerprint. Understanding what your Toyota VIN says can help in many scenarios:
Identifying Recalls
Manufacturers use VINs to identify which vehicles are affected by recalls. Some states even allow checking recall status by VIN for older vehicles still in operation.
Vehicle History Verification
Whether you’re purchasing a used car or researching your current vehicle’s maintenance history, services such as Carfax or AutoCheck can use the VIN to reveal incidents like accident history, flood damage, or odometer tampering.
Insurance and Registration
Insurance companies and government registries use VINs to verify vehicle identities and specifications. Incorrect entry can delay or deny policy approval.
Part Purchases and Repairs
Accurate VIN decoding helps ensure parts compatibility. Different trim lines and engine configurations have critical variations—knowing your vehicle’s specs from the VIN ensures you receive OEM-quality parts tailored to your model.
Tracking Stolen Vehicles
Law enforcement databases track VINs of stolen vehicles. If your car is recovered, a VIN check confirms its authentic origin.

Where can I find the VIN on a Toyota vehicle?
The VIN on a Toyota vehicle can typically be found in several locations. The most common place is on the driver’s side dashboard, visible through the windshield. It is also often etched on a sticker located on the driver’s side door jamb. Additionally, it appears on official documents like vehicle registration, insurance policies, and auto history reports.
For digital access, the VIN is included on the vehicle’s title and may be accessible through dealership systems using your car’s key fob or connected apps like Toyota’s own myT system. Knowing where to locate the VIN is essential when looking up information such as recalls, service history, or for conducting background checks when buying a used Toyota.

What information does the check digit provide in a Toyota VIN?
The ninth character in the VIN is known as the check digit, a security feature used to validate the authenticity of the entire VIN. It is determined by a mathematical calculation that involves the other 16 characters. When run through a standard algorithm, the result must match the check digit to confirm the VIN is valid and hasn’t been altered or misquoted.
This digit plays an important role in preventing fraud and ensuring accurate identification of Toyota vehicles during registration, insurance, and recall notifications. If the check digit does not match the calculation, it is a red flag indicating a possibly altered, cloned, or forged VIN. This becomes especially important when purchasing used vehicles or verifying the VIN after repairs or replacements.
